site stats

S3 kms key policy

WebApr 10, 2024 · This is a great way to assign permissions to specific IAM Users rather than doing it via a Bucket Policy. The Amazon S3 console does allow you to Review bucket access using Access Analyzer for S3: ... when you allow KMS encryption you can also control access to data via the KMS key. That is something worth to consider for sensitive … WebFeb 10, 2024 · Step 1a: Create the S3 bucket management policy While logged in to the console as your Admin user, create an IAM policy in the web console using the JSON tab. …

Granting permissions to publish event notification messages to a ...

WebApr 11, 2024 · D. Assign the same KMS key used to encrypt data in Amazon S3 to the Amazon SageMaker notebook instance. Answer: D Reference: QUESTION NO: 71 A Data Scientist needs to migrate an existing on-premises ETL process to the cloud. The current process runs at regular time intervals and uses PySpark to combine and format multiple … WebFeb 19, 2024 · To get started, create a KMS key and configure it with the permission to GenerateDataKey and Decrypt. You can then provide the KMS key to AWS Config by calling the PutDeliveryChannel API with your S3 KMS key, ARN, or alias ARN. The objects delivered to the S3 bucket will be encrypted using server-side encryption with KMS CMKs. joyce meyer trial https://aminokou.com

How to use KMS and IAM to enable independent security controls …

WebThe only way to verify that the encrypted data key is indeed the ciphertext of the plaintext data key is that the service needs to have the kms:Decrypt permission to decrypt the ciphertext and make sure the output is exactly the same as the plaintext data key returned in the GenerateDataKey API response. Share Improve this answer Follow WebRequired Permissions for the AWS KMS Key When Using Service-Linked Roles (S3 Bucket Delivery) Granting AWS Config access to the AWS KMS Key Required Permissions for the … WebJul 28, 2024 · My generated S3 bucket was empty; so I tried adding an AWSLogs folder there encrypted by the same specified KMS key (I hadn't set a prefix, but that would need to be the top level directory name if you do). The Terraform apply passed for me after that. I hope that helps! Edit to add: There seems to be an order of operations issue too. joyce meyer tour

How to use KMS and IAM to enable independent security controls …

Category:put_key_policy - Boto3 1.26.111 documentation

Tags:S3 kms key policy

S3 kms key policy

Support for KMS encryption on S3 buckets used by AWS Config

WebApr 17, 2024 · 今回は、AWSのS3バケットをKMSのCustomer Managed Keyを使って暗号化します。 1.暗号化するS3バケットを用意する 2.KMSで今回のデモに利用する暗号化キーを用意する 3.S3バケットのデフォルト暗号化を「AWS-KMS」に変更する 4.デフォルト暗号化が有効になっていることを確認する 1.暗号化するS3バケットとファイルを用意する … WebApr 6, 2024 · Configure KMS Encryption for your S3 Bucket Navigate to the AWS S3 service Search for a bucket by name and select the bucket From the Properties tab, scroll to …

S3 kms key policy

Did you know?

WebApr 14, 2024 · Currently, S3 supports encrypting data with AWS Key Management Service (KMS). AWS KMS is a managed service for the creation and management of encryption keys used to encrypt data. In addition, S3 supports customers using their own encryption keys to … WebJul 6, 2016 · To implement this policy, navigate to the S3 console and follow these steps: Choose the target bucket in the left pane. Expand Permissions in the right pane, and choose Edit bucket policy. Copy the following policy, paste it …

WebAug 26, 2024 · The key policy can pass the permission responsibilities to be managed by IAM policies instead of the KMS CMK key policies. A CMK can be set to enable or disable at any time to allow usage or stop the usage of the key. Key Alias are a great way to tag and identify Customer managed CMKs. WebJan 10, 2024 · You need to create a customer managed KMS key (CMK) and update the KMS key policy to use the key for decryption. Use that encryption key when you put items in the bucket. Make sure the KMS policy is least privilege! Share Follow answered Jan 11, 2024 at 4:25 Chris Pollard 1,585 8 11

WebThere are two possible values for the x-amz-server-side-encryption header: AES256, which tells S3 to use S3-managed keys, and aws:kms, which tells S3 to use AWS KMS – managed keys. Incorrect options: Configure the bucket policy to deny if the PutObject does not have an s3:x-amz-acl header set to private - The x-amz-acl header is used to ... WebWorking with Amazon EC2 key pairs; Describe Amazon EC2 Regions and Availability Zones; Working with security groups in Amazon EC2; Using Elastic IP addresses in Amazon EC2; AWS Identity and Access Management examples

WebNov 21, 2024 · Similar to Amazon S3, Amazon RDS also depends on AWS KMS for manage keys. The default key is /aws/rds but one can specify the ARN for an encryption key explicitly as well (see Figure 5).

WebAWS Key Management Service (AWS KMS) examples Toggle child pages in navigation Encrypt and decrypt a file Amazon S3 examples Toggle child pages in navigation Amazon S3 buckets Uploading files Downloading files File transfer configuration Presigned URLs Bucket policies Access permissions Using an Amazon S3 bucket as a static web host how to make a forum website in htmlWebAmazon KMS key policy If the SQS queue or SNS topics are encrypted with an Amazon Key Management Service (Amazon KMS) customer managed key, you must grant the Amazon S3 service principal permission to work with the encrypted topics or queue. how to make a forum website for freeWebFeb 10, 2024 · Step 1a: Create the S3 bucket management policy While logged in to the console as your Admin user, create an IAM policy in the web console using the JSON tab. Name the policy secure-bucket-admin. When you reach the step to type or paste a JSON policy document, paste the JSON from Listing 1 below. how to make a fossil for kidsWebIf the get-bucket-encryption command output returns "aws:kms" as value for the "SSEAlgorithm" attribute, check the Amazon Resource Name (ARN) referenced by the "KMSMasterKeyID" attribute.If the key ARN is "arn:aws:kms:us-east-1: :alias/aws/s3", where is the ID of your AWS account, the Server-Side … how to make a foundation sims 4WebA key policy is a resource policy for an AWS KMS key. Key policies are the primary way to control access to KMS keys. Every KMS key must have exactly one key policy. The statements in the key policy determine who has permission to use the KMS key and how … A grant is a policy instrument that allows AWS principals to use KMS keys in … To add or remove key administrators, and to allow or prevent key administrators … To use an IAM policy to control access to a KMS key, the key policy for the KMS key … For each volume, Amazon EBS asks AWS KMS to generate a unique data key … To reduce the volume of Amazon S3 calls to AWS KMS, use Amazon S3 bucket … how to make a forums websiteWebThe AWS KMS key policy in Account A must grant access to the user in Account B. The IAM policy in Account B must grant the user access to both the bucket and the AWS KMS key in Account A. For more information about how to add or correct the IAM user's permissions, see Changing permissions for an IAM user. Related information AWS Policy Generator joyce meyer tv offersWebMar 22, 2024 · This script work (it applies), but when checking in the AWS console, no KMS keys are selected for the source object. Looking at the configuration, I can't see anywhere to specify these keys. The replica_kms_key_id is to specify the KMS key to use for encrypting the objects in the destination bucket. amazon-s3 terraform terraform-provider-aws Share how to make a foundation lighter